A train trip from Alexandra Palace to Bournemouth takes about 3hrs 14 mins on average, covering roughly 96 miles (155 kilometres). With around 57 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£14.90,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Alexandra Palace station boasts a range of facilities to enhance your travel experience. Even if you're rushing to catch the train, you can easily purchase or collect your tickets at the station. The ticket office is open from 06:15 to 12:40 on weekdays and 09:00 to 15:25 on Saturdays. Alternatively, ticket machines are available for those on the go. All machines support disabled access, facilitating a smoother travel experience for those in need.
Moreover, for those looking to use new technology, smartcards are issued and can be validated at the station. While there are no waiting rooms, seating areas are available, and you can relax at the available refreshment facilities or peruse the on-site shops and ATMs.
While Alexandra Palace station is equipped with many amenities, it's important to note the station does not provide step-free access. However, staff assistance is on offer around the clock, ensuring all passengers can navigate the station with ease. Whether your travel is booked in advance or spontaneous, you are encouraged to arrive 20 minutes prior to departure to arrange assistance for your onward journey.
Transport links at Alexandra Palace are diverse and well-integrated, making onward travel convenient. The station provides a taxi rank at its entrance, ensuring quick and easy road access. Bus services are also available, with route information accessible through their 'Onward Travel Information Map.' For those requiring rail replacement services, detailed information can be accessed at the station.

The station ensures a seamless experience with a comprehensive array of facilities. Whether buying a ticket or picking up one pre-purchased online, passengers can utilize the ticket machines which are accessible for all, including those with disabilities. The station also offers smartcards for a modern touch to your travel needs. For any assistance, staff help is widely available through help points, information screens, and the dedicated Customer Service Centre, ensuring that a helpful hand is never far away. Additionally, there's step-free access throughout the station, including long ramps for ease of movement.
Bournemouth Train Station might lack a traditional waiting room, but there's ample seating available for travelers awaiting departure. While it does not offer lounge services, refreshments can be found on Platforms 2 and 3, including a Starbucks. Best not to rely on finding ATMs or shops here, however. For those needing to stay connected, complimentary public Wi-Fi is available, with helpful links to hotspots around the station.
Travelers will benefit from the station's excellent transport connectivity. For those moving onward by car, there are 362 parking spaces available and specially marked bays for Blue Badge holders. If you arrive by bike, there are 118 spaces with sheltered cycle storage under CCTV. For public transportation users, buses and taxis provide seamless travel to further destinations. The airport is easily accessible via Morebus service 737, while the station is a pivotal access point for rail replacement services reaching Southampton and Poole.
